Lot 4367

Patton, George (1885-1945) American general and tank commander; considered one of the greatest military leaders in history. Autograph Letter Signed ("G.S. Patton Jr."), n.p., November 15 (19)18, 1½ pp, quarto. Written to his mother, four days after the Allied armistice with Germany was signed.

"Dear Mama, Well it is over and I at least am not pleased. I had just perfected a new formation which I should have love to have tried also I would like to have rescued a man under fire so as to get the Medal of Honor. Also at my present rate I might have gotten a star for which I should now have to wait a long time. / But I have always looked at this war as a means for getting into position for the next one for I have no desire that Nita [his sister] should be the only four star member of the family [Nita was engaged to Pershing for about a year]. / So just as I braved at West Point the day I was turned back in order to be just Corporal next year I am on the job here just as if the war were still on. At least no one can ever say of me that I grudged working for interest I wanted nor that I hid behind my rank. As Gen R[achenbach] told men who joked him about my being hit in the but [sic], 'By God no one can make fun of Patton who was not in front of him and that limits it to the Boche. / Here is a poem [not present] I wrote on the death of one of my Captains he was truly a fine officer and died 300 m. ahead of his men. Further than I got. / I am feeling fine and got rid of my bandages on the 11th of the month to celebrate the victory…."
Estimated Value $6,000 - 8,000.

 
Realized $6,900
